NIEHS Pilot Project Grants
The Johns Hopkins NIEHS Center in Urban Environmental
Health is
offering both individual pilot project grants of up to
$25,000 and multi-investigator, interdisciplinary
and translational grants of up to $50,000 for the period
April 1, 2009, to March 31, 2010.
These grants aim to stimulate new research in
environmental exposure and health assessment,
molecular basis of environmental disease, public health
intervention and prevention of environmental
disease, and community outreach and environmental health
education.

2008 Electronic W-2 Forms
Members of the Johns Hopkins community can register to
receive
2008 W-2 forms electronically. There are several advantages
to receiving the forms this way. The W-2 will be available
sooner than a printed copy; when the W-2 is available, a
notification will be sent to the e-mail address you provide
at the time you register; the W-2 can be printed from the
Web and/or
saved as a PDF file on a home computer; the form can be
imported directly into tax software such as
TurboTax; and a copy of the W-2 can be reprinted during the
year, free of charge. No action is
required if you registered last year to receive your W-2
electronically.

Drive for Hurricane Victims of Haiti
The Caribbean Cultural Society, Black Faculty and Staff
Association, and the Children and Families Global
Development Fund are sponsoring and soliciting
donations for Petit Goave, a town located south of
Port-au-Prince, Haiti, with a population of around
12,000. Items needed include aspirin, latex gloves,
toiletries and medical supplies such as peroxide and
antibiotic cream.
